Annatto has emerged as a high-priority ingredient for formulators, product developers, and supply chain strategists because it simultaneously satisfies aesthetic, functional, and sustainability criteria sought by modern consumers. The seed-derived pigments and extracts offer natural color, lipid-soluble and water-soluble functionality, and ancillary bioactive properties that can be leveraged across food, personal care, pharmaceutical, and textile applications. As consumer demand for clean-label and naturally derived inputs intensifies, annatto's historical role as a traditional dye has evolved into a strategic ingredient that supports reformulation, premiumization, and claims differentiation.
Beyond its immediate application as a colorant, annatto's processing versatility-from emulsified and solvent-extracted concentrates to oil-soluble and water-soluble formats-enables integration into complex product matrices. Supply-side developments and innovation in extraction and stabilization are increasing confidence in annatto's performance, reducing formulation trade-offs that previously pushed manufacturers toward synthetic alternatives. Consequently, procurement, R&D, and regulatory teams are elevating annatto in ingredient roadmaps as they balance cost, functionality, and sustainability targets.

Market dynamics for annatto are being reshaped by several converging shifts in consumer behavior, technology, and regulation that together are altering demand patterns and supply priorities. First, the ascent of clean-label expectations has moved procurement discussions from price-led sourcing to value-led sourcing, emphasizing traceability, minimal processing claims, and transparency in ingredient origins. This shift favors suppliers and processors that can demonstrate chain-of-custody, lower-impact extraction, and clearly documented ingredient provenance.
Second, sustainability and regenerative agriculture considerations are altering supply chain risk assessments and supplier relationships. Stakeholders increasingly prioritize sourcing models that demonstrate reduced environmental footprint and social accountability, which encourages longer-term partnerships with growers and cooperatives that can provide verifiable sustainability outcomes. Third, processing innovation is influencing how annatto is formulated; advancements in solvent systems, encapsulation, and emulsion technology have improved color stability, heat resistance, and compatibility with diverse product matrices, broadening annatto's technical applicability.
Finally, regulatory transparency and harmonization efforts in several markets are increasing scrutiny of colorant ingredients and their labeling, which creates both constraints and opportunities. As a result, industry players who invest in robust regulatory intelligence and compliance capability can convert regulatory adherence into a competitive advantage. Together, these transformative shifts are creating a landscape in which product developers, supply chain leaders, and sustainability teams must collaborate more closely to realize annatto's full commercial potential.

A granular review of segmentation reveals distinct commercial and technical dynamics that influence product strategy across the annatto value chain. Based on type, demand patterns differ among emulsified and solvent-extracted annatto, oil-soluble variants, and water-soluble preparations, each addressing unique formulation challenges and processing constraints. Emulsified and solvent-extracted forms often appeal to applications requiring concentrated pigment delivery and stability in complex matrices, whereas oil-soluble variants align with lipid-rich systems and water-soluble preparations serve aqueous formulations.
Based on source, commercial and regulatory narratives diverge between conventional and organic annatto, with organic supply commanding specific cultivation and certification practices that affect sourcing flexibility and supplier relationships. Based on product form, liquid, paste, and powder offerings each present trade-offs in handling, transportation, and shelf life; liquid and paste forms frequently offer ease of dispersion while powders can simplify dry blending and extended storage. Based on packaging type, bottles, jars and containers, and pouches are selected for considerations of dose accuracy, shelf presentation, and cost-efficient distribution, and packaging innovations increasingly intersect with sustainability objectives.
Based on end-user, the market serves Cosmetic & Personal Care, Food & Beverages, Pharmaceutical, and Textiles, with finer specialization inside these categories. Cosmetic & Personal Care demand spans color cosmetics, haircare products, and skincare products where aesthetic and sensory performance are critical. Food & Beverages applications include bakery products, dairy products, and snack foods that require performance under thermal and pH stresses. Pharmaceutical use cases focus on supplements, syrups, and topical medications where purity, excipient compatibility, and regulatory compliance are paramount. Textile applications emphasize dye uptake and washfastness. Based on distribution channel, both offline and online routes influence purchase behavior, with offline activity concentrated in retail chains and specialty stores and online activity taking place through company websites and e-commerce platforms; channel choice shapes order cadence, packaging requirements, and service expectations.
